About KEV:

KEV Group is an enterprise SaaS company that provides an all-in-one activity fund management solution for K-12 schools. By seamlessly integrating and automating all fee management processes, our SchoolCash platform provides real-time visibility and control over how districts and schools create, collect, manage, track, and reconcile these funds. Parents benefit from an easy-to-use solution that offers convenience and supports all payment types. More than 26,000 schools across North America rely on our solutions to manage over $4 billion in activity funds annually.


The company is headquartered in Toronto with offices in Cambridge, ON and across the U.S., KEV is a portfolio company of Five Arrows. Job Description

KEV is seeking a strong, experienced DevOps Engineer to join our Technology Operations team.  Reporting to the Director, Technology Operations & Security, you will be responsible for effectively managing the DevOps environment and the build and deployment processes within.  This will require understanding the architecture of each application and ensuring they match with the business requirements.

Responsibilities:

  • Work closely with development teams to understand project requirements and deploy application builds into various environments, ensuring smooth and timely releases.
  • Partner with developers to create and maintain detailed environment diagrams for each application, ensuring correct configuration and seamless integration across systems. 
  • Apply automation, Infrastructure as Code (IaC), and CI/CD principles to enhance deployment reliability while reducing manual steps, focusing on minimizing downtime. 
  • Coordinate with the broader DevOps team to audit and verify configuration settings before deployments, so that each application meets operational standards and performance criteria. 
  • Oversee the release pipelines in Azure DevOps, including monitoring, approving, and tracking releases, build numbers, and overall application version integrity. 
  • Provide continuous support for applications post-deployment, troubleshooting issues, gathering developer feedback, and implementing improvements to enhance stability and performance. 
  • Research, plan, and implement infrastructure changes that directly benefit application performance, including server setups, load balancing, and proxy configurations. 
  • Develop and maintain comprehensive documentation to support application changes, deployments, and troubleshooting processes, ensuring clear communication across teams. 
  • Lead and manage projects and incident resolutions through an IT ticketing system, coordinating investigations and responses in partnership with both development and support teams. 
  • Participate in an on-call rotation to manage after-hours jobs, alerts and escalations, ensuring rapid resolution of any application-related issues.

Requirements and Skills: 

  • 3–5 years of experience in application support with a strong background in utilizing DevOps practices, particularly within the Microsoft Azure ecosystem and Azure DevOps. 
  • Post-secondary degree, diploma, or equivalent technical certification in a relevant field. Microsoft Certifications are a strong asset. 
  • Prior experience in SaaS support and delivery, with a focus on both IaaS and PaaS solutions within Azure environments using Azure DevOps, Octopus, etc. 
  • Hands-on experience with Infrastructure as Code, particularly as it relates to configuring and managing Azure-based systems with ARM, Bicep and/or Terraform. 
  • Solid understanding of security principles in complex ecosystems and proficiency with debugging and diagnostic tools to resolve application issues effectively. 
  • Ability to automate common tasks with PowerShell, PowerAutomate, Azure Functions. 
  • Experience managing traditional server-based environments, including SFTP, IIS and SQL Server, as well as supporting third-party and in-house applications. 
  • Excellent communication skills for clear and effective collaboration with developers, management, and technical teams. 
  • Configuration hardening against standards such as NIST, STIG’s, CIS Benchmarks, etc.  
  • Working in a regulated environment like PCI, SOC II, ISO27001, HIPAA, HITRUST, etc.  
  • Ability to work effectively both independently and as part of a collaborative team. 
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ills with a proactive approach to investigating, troubleshooting, and resolving application issues.
